Winter Solstice
By Thea Summer Deer ©2012
I love these winter skies,
and the ice that hangs from eves,
the view through barren trees
reveals what could not before be seen.
In winter Cardinals dressed in red,
dance upon a stage of white,
and a brilliant star of dazzling light
guides me west, and home at night.
I love these mountain woods,
where the bobcat watches as I stand
before the fire to warm my hands,
We welcome winter solstice with its breath of cold demand.
In winter the black bear sleeps,
where I may join her in my dreams.
She takes me down by inner streams,
and reveals what could not before be seen.
